Gevora Hotel: A Vertical Marvel in Dubai

The Gevora Hotel, situated on Sheikh Zayed Road, is a symbol of vertical luxury in Dubai. Inaugurated in 2018, this towering structure has claimed the Guinness title of the world's tallest hotel, standing at an impressive height.

Located at the foot of Financial Metro Station, the Gevora Hotel is easily accessible. A mere quarter of an hour away from Dubai International Airport, it offers convenience for both leisure and business travellers.

The hotel's lobby is a sight to behold, with solid-gold revolving doors, crystal chandeliers, and precious marble. As you step inside, you are immediately immersed in understated elegance and refinement, a theme that continues throughout the Deluxe Rooms, which feature a yellow, beige, and black palette.

The Gevora Hotel offers an extraordinary observatory over Dubai's skyline, providing each room with a privileged view of the city. The largest suites offer 85 m² of luxury with sweeping views of Dubai Marina.

The hotel's dining options cater to all tastes. Gevora Kitchen serves international cuisine throughout the day, while Veyron Café on the ground floor specializes in specialty coffee and delicate bites. For a panoramic outlook of the city, head to the Highest View Lounge, located at 280 metres high, or the Overview Pool Lounge on the 12th floor, which offers aquatic leisure, culinary delights, and a panoramic view.

The rooftop, with paid access, offers a 360-degree view of the city, particularly magical at sunset. Kite Beach and La Mer are just ten minutes away, providing guests with easy access to Dubai's beautiful beaches.

The construction of the Gevora Hotel required 12 years and a 30-metre-square base with deep foundations for stability. Originally designed as a residential tower, it was converted into a hotel during construction. Despite its luxury status, the Gevora Hotel offers an accessible vertical immersion at relatively modest rates for a four-star hotel. Embodying modern Dubai where skyscrapers have become the new urban landmarks, the Gevora Hotel offers a unique blend of luxury, convenience, and affordability.

Before the Gevora Hotel, the JW Marriott Marquis held the title of the world's tallest hotel. However, the Gevora Hotel has since taken the crown, offering a vertiginous experience for those seeking to explore Dubai from new heights.
